On 2/11/21 12:43 AM, Philippe Mathieu-Daudé wrote:
> Use the new clock_ns_to_ticks() function in cp0_timer where
> appropriate. This allows us to remove CPUMIPSState::cp0_count_ns
> and mips_cp0_period_set().
> 
> Signed-off-by: Philippe Mathieu-Daudé <f4bug@amsat.org>
> ---
> Based-on: <20210209132040.5091-1-peter.maydell@linaro.org>
> 
> RFC because this is just a starter patch to test Peter's series
> providing a handy function which "tells me how many times this
> clock would tick in this length of time".
> 
> Also because we could rethink the MIPS CP0 timer logic to avoid
> too frequent divu128 calls (painful on 32-bit hosts).
> 
> The style should be updated, using more variables for easier
> review. env_archcpu() could eventually be dropped (by passing
> MIPSCPU* instead of CPUMIPSState*).

I guess it is better to wait for Peter patches to get merged
before posting the updated patches (not much, just one previous
patch MIPSCPU* instead of CPUMIPSState*).
